本文给出设计30m×36m平板网架的五种方案,比较了各种方案构造情况、杆件最大内力最大挠度、杆件用钢量、节点用钢量及总耗钢指标;讨论了不同网架厚度对杆件内力、挠度和耗钢量的影响。用近似法和精确法计算了五种方案的网架主要杆件内力大小,并比较了计算结果及分布规律,分析了近似计算误差范围及产生的原因,以供设计时参考。
In this paper, five schemes for designing a 30m×36m flat-screen grid are presented, and comparisons are made between the construction of various schemes, the maximum deflection of the maximum internal force of the bar, the amount of steel used for the bar, the amount of steel used for the joints, and the total consumption index; The effect of shelf thickness on internal forces, deflections, and steel consumption. The internal forces of the main members of the five kinds of schemes were calculated using the approximate method and the exact method. The calculation results and distribution rules were compared. The error range of the approximate calculation and the causes were analyzed to provide reference for the design.
